Treatment Services for the Hearing Impaired - Alcohol and Drug Treatment Programs - Oakland, IL.

Drug treatment services for the hearing impaired are available in both an outpatient and inpatient setting. People with hearing impairment can be at a greater risk of substance abuse disorders due to their disability. living with a major disability can be a source of distress, discouragement, depression, unhappiness and apathy for both adults and adolescents who could easily turn to drugs or alcohol to cope with these emotions. Hearing impaired treatment services are offered in Oakland to help resolve addiction for these clients, with ASL and other assistance which includes treatment information and education in writing so that patients aren't hindered from receiving help due to their impairment.

Addiction rehabilitation facilities with full time staff to assist the hearing impaired are the most appropriate programs to consider. Some facilities may only have part-time staff to assist and interpret this demographic, and this means hearing impaired clients won't receive the same treatment as everyone else and will miss out on essential activities they should be attending every day. There could be video presentations available which utilize sign language as well, which is also really helpful.

There are organizations and agencies that give hearing impaired people struggling with addiction with resources and information to discover and locate the recovery services they need. One is the Deaf Off Drugs and Alcohol (DODA).
